Smart Weather Sensors
Smart climate sensing units have actually reinvented the efficiency of contemporary watering systems by adjusting sprinkling timetables based on real-time ecological data. These sensing units keep an eye on variables such as temperature level, humidity, wind speed, and solar radiation, allowing systems to react dynamically to transforming weather problems. By integrating this information, clever sensors can enhance water usage, lowering waste and making sure that landscapes get the ideal amount of dampness. This technology not just conserves water yet additionally advertises healthier plant development by preventing overwatering or underwatering. Additionally, the automation supplied by smart climate sensing units enhances individual benefit, as landscaping companies and property owners can depend on precise watering schedules without hands-on treatment. On the whole, these advancements represent a considerable improvement in sustainable watering methods.

Soil Wetness Sensors
Soil wetness sensing units play a vital duty in modern irrigation systems, providing real-time data that boosts water efficiency. These tools determine the volumetric water material in the soil, enabling specific assessments of dampness degrees. By incorporating dirt dampness sensors into irrigation systems, users can avoid overwatering or underwatering, eventually advertising much healthier plant growth and conserving water resources.The sensors transmit information to controllers, which can change watering schedules based on current soil problems. This data-driven method lessens water waste and assurances that plants obtain the best quantity of dampness. In addition, soil wetness sensors can be useful in different agricultural settings, from home yards to massive ranches. The deployment of these sensors adds to sustainable methods by sustaining responsible water usage and reducing ecological influence. On the whole, the consolidation of dirt dampness sensing units marks a considerable advancement in achieving effective irrigation systems.
